    Chris Lujan & Electric Butter FRATERNITY MUSIC GROUP release!!!

    Ice Cold
    (C. Lujan)

    Joe Baer Magnant - Guitar
    Raynier Jacob Jacildo - Hammond Organ, Fender Rhodes
    Chris Lujan - Fender Bass
    Micah McClain - Drums

    Dirty, instrumental soul/funk by Chris Lujan (The M-Tet) and his newly minted solo project, Electric Butter. Recorded live at Lugnut Brand HQ on the Tascam 388, this single delivers a heavy vibe reminiscent of the past with a touch of the now. Heavy Hammond Organ, sweet guitar, chimey Fender Rhodes, heavy bass and drums. This one is fit for sampling. Can you dig it?

    East Bay, West Coast
    (C. Lujan)

    Erik Mekkelson - Tenor Sax
    Gary Pitman - Fender Rhodes
    Chris Hazelton - Hammond Organ
    Chris Lujan - Fender Bass
    Michael Reed - Drums

    Fuzzed Bass, screaming Hammond Organ, Tenor Sax, Rhodes Electric Piano, and some hard chugging Boom-Bap Drums? What else do you need?!

    Written over 20 years ago and finally seeing it's official release.

    Recorded on the Tascam 388 at Lugnut Brand HQ in the Bay Area. The tape then made it's way to Kansas City where Chris Hazelton made the Hammond scream. Then, back to Lugnut Brand HQ for the finishing touches.
